This was my virgin attempt at fondant and gum paste. When I first read up on fondant and gum paste, it was described as "baker's play dough" which made me think,"shouldn't be tough?". Well, I was right and wrong. Fondant which I made at home, was speckled with bits of gelatin, but was a dream to knead. It really was like play dough, except edible! Gum paste on the contrary, which I specially purchased Tylose (aka CMC) powder to make, was a nightmare. Like I said in my post here, it was ROCK hard. No make it DIAMOND hard. But I had to use gum paste for the fairy figurine I was going to make for my lil girl, since ALL the websites that i researched on insists that gum paste be used for flowers and figurines. Doesn't help also that the characteristics of gum paste is such that it dries up quickly, even more so than fondant, plus the fact that I suffer from mild OCD, so it took me one friggin day to make the pair of LEGS. All in all, I reckon I must have spent almost a week on just the fairy alone. BUT BUT BUT, it was fun. I enjoyed the making of it despite the frustrations and expletives that were strewn out in the process.
